- Cannot call action &1 of business object &2 ?The SAP error message
/IAM/CONFIG_INT007 Cannot call action &1 of business object &2
typically occurs in the context of SAP Identity Management (IdM) or related systems when there is an issue with invoking a specific action on a business object. This error can arise due to various reasons, including configuration issues, missing authorizations, or problems with the business object itself.Causes:
Configuration Issues: The action or business object may not be properly configured in the system. This could include missing or incorrect settings in the configuration files or the IdM system.
Authorization Problems: The user or process attempting to call the action may not have the necessary authorizations to perform that action on the specified business object.
Business Object Issues: The business object itself may not be defined correctly, or there may be issues with its implementation.
Technical Errors: There could be underlying technical issues, such as problems with the database, network issues, or other system errors that prevent the action from being executed.
Solutions:
Check Configuration: Review the configuration settings for the business object and the action in question. Ensure that all necessary parameters are correctly set up.
Verify Authorizations: Check the user roles and authorizations to ensure that the user or process has the necessary permissions to call the action on the business object.
Review Business Object Definition: Ensure that the business object is correctly defined in the system. This includes checking for any missing attributes or incorrect mappings.
Check Logs: Look at the application logs for more detailed error messages or stack traces that can provide additional context about the failure.
Test the Action: If possible, try to manually invoke the action through the SAP GUI or another interface to see if the error persists. This can help isolate whether the issue is with the action itself or the way it is being called.
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or support notes related to the specific business object and action to see if there are known issues or additional configuration steps required.
Contact SAP Support: If the issue persists after checking the above points, consider reaching out to SAP support for further assistance, providing them with detailed information about the error and the context in which it occurs.
